Property Overview: 627 Matheson Avenue, Winnipeg

Section 1: Key Characteristics & Appeal

This one-and-a-half storey home, built in 1949, presents a solid opportunity in Winnipeg's Jefferson neighbourhood. Its key strength is the generous 6,715 sqft lot, which ranks in the top 3% of the area, offering significant outdoor space and potential that is increasingly rare. The home itself, at 1,155 sqft of living area, is modestly sized but functional, featuring a renovated basement and a detached garage.

The appeal lies in its balanced profile and clear value proposition. The assessed value sits well above average for both the street and the Jefferson area, suggesting a perception of good relative worth. It suits practical buyers looking for a manageable home without sacrificing yard size—perfect for those with gardening ambitions, pets, or who simply value private outdoor room to grow into. It’s also a sensible fit for first-time buyers or downsizers seeking a established neighbourhood character without the premium of a newer build. A less obvious perspective is that the above-average lot size in a neighbourhood of mostly smaller parcels could provide a future hedge, as redevelopment or expansion options may be more feasible here than on neighbouring properties.
